ALS Diagnosis, Medicare Cliff: Franklins' Retirement Crisis
Jean Franklin, a sixty-three-year-old from Colusa, California, faced unexpected health issues and a massive health insurance premium hike, which strained her retirement savings. Despite qualifying for Medicare, her premiums remain high, forcing her family to dip into savings and make tough choices. This situation is shared by millions of Americans, with twenty-two million hit by subsidy cuts, leading to increased enrollment in Obamacare. Experts warn of tough choices and potential drops in coverage, while patient advocates emphasize the importance of maintaining health insurance.
